VG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2015 in Review

190 of the 3,812 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Vonage Holdings Corporation (VG) for Q4 2015, worth a combined $976M — down 2.2% from $998M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 35 funds opened new VG positions and 18 closed out — a net gain of 17 holders — while 73 added to existing stakes and 58 trimmed.

The largest buyer was First Trust Advisors, adding an estimated $13.8M. The largest seller was JP Morgan Chase, cutting an estimated $9.06M.
